# Copy data between entities

Sometimes data isn’t just relevant to one entity. For example, the industry value could be relevant to the company and the job. Having this type of information readily available can save time and help you get a clearer view of opportunities, such as easily seeing how many jobs you have open in a specific industry.

We know manual data entry is time consuming, and we also know that incomplete data impacts your reporting and integrations that rely on data, such as Bullhorn Automation. And that’s why we added the copy functionality to Kyloe DataTools.

<details>

<summary><strong>Fix it with Kyloe DataTools</strong></summary>

**Automatically copy information between associated records**. This could be populating invoice formatting from company to placement, bill rates from job to placement, copying placement information to candidate record, among others!
